Retrospective Planning Permission
If building works start and planning permission is required and has not been obtained, a retrospective planning permission will be required to regularise the development. A 'retrospective planning application' is essentially an application that is submitted in order to obtain planning permission for the development.
An owner or developer should never rely on a retrospective planning permission application to get unauthorised development approved. Anyone doing this is taking a considerable risk and may face formal enforcement action.
